There are several other bugs that can produce uncompilable LaTeX output.įinally, even if you decide to export the whole document to LaTeX, it will generally be necessary to go through the source with a text editor to clean up formatting problems.*)īecause inter-word spaces are omitted upon export. Avoid comments in Mathematica code of the type (*.(that's poor man's bold, and it deserves the name) Use ToRadicals to get Mathematica to (attempt to) expand these Root objects. The Mathematica function TeXForm produces a LaTeX representation of a syntactically correctĮxpression, often trying to apply conventional typesetting rules. Note that Mathematica can calculate symbolic results for the roots of any polynomial of order 3 or 4, as well as certain higher-order polynomials it just doesn't do so by default. Create LaTeX code from arbitrary Mathematica expressions:.This is a selective approach that works well when you aren't interested in moving text between Mathematica and LaTeX, only equations: If you're not interested in using LaTeX, look instead at converting Mathematica formulas to PDF. Do Sum Product NestList NestWhileList SparseArray RecurrenceTable BooleanTable DiscretePlot ParallelTable ConstantArray StringRepeat FindRepeat Related Guides. Although LaTeX code is semantically ambiguous, it can serve as a bridge connecting these applications. In going back and forth between Mathematica and LyX, it's convenient that both of them understand LaTeX. This is the reason why I do the bulk of my writing in LyX – it is not only a LaTeX frontend, but it moreover leaves you immense freedom to customize and export the document. Converting cells between different forms (StandardForm, InputForm) will even shuffle around newlines. because important editor functions (such citation management, and publication-ready PDF output) are missing. Mathematica doesnt really respect lines, it pushes working at the expression level when possible (not at the source text level). However, for larger documents, I find that impractical. Some people prefer to do all their writing in Mathematica. Here is some information on how to convert formulas from Mathematica to LaTeX and vice versa (see also this post).įor my writing I always use LyX, a LaTeX editor and front end that can format equations while you type them. Editing, copying and pasting Mathematica equations via LaTeX
0 Comments
Leave a Reply. |